Problem

Traditional wired power solutions and wire harnesses can limit design flexibility, complicate manufacturing processes, and are prone to failure in harsh environments. Slip rings and brushes used for powering rotating components degrade over time and add bulk to designs.

Solution

Solace Power provides wireless power and data transfer solutions using Resonant Capacitive Coupling (RCC) technology. This technology eliminates the need for physical connections, enabling power delivery through barriers and in challenging conditions. Solace's systems enhance design agility, simplify production, and improve reliability by removing vulnerable connectors. The contactless nature of RCC is particularly beneficial for powering rotating components, allowing for fully sealed designs and eliminating wear and tear.

Features

  • Wireless power transfer up to 3kW
  • Data transfer rates up to 1Gbps
  • Transfer distance up to 40cm
  • Ability to power through barriers such as glass and walls
  • No heating of nearby metals due to resonant capacitive coupling
  • Solutions for replacing wire harnesses, powering rotating components, and delivering heat to surfaces
  • Compliant with EMI and safety standards
